Old Armenian [edit]

Etymology [edit]

From Parthian *gōsān. Attested in Persian as گوسان (gōsān) and کوسان (kōsān), from Middle Persian *kōsān, *gōsān. The origin of the Parthian word is uncertain; according to Ačaṙyan it is derived from Armenian գովասան (govasan, praiser).
